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ations

  • Coat brightness and maintenance: For white or light coats, choose formulas designed to brighten without yellowing or dulling the fur. Whitening shampoos often include conditioning agents to prevent dry hair.
  • Skin sensitivity: If your Bichon Frise has sensitive or itchy skin, look for hypoallergenic, pH-balanced options with soothing ingredients like chamomile, oatmeal, aloe vera, or avocado.
  • Grooming routine and puppy considerations: Tearless or puppy-specific shampoos reduce irritation around the face and eyes, making daily or weekly baths easier for curious puppies and new owners.
  • Odor control: Deodorizing formulas help extend the interval between baths and keep the dog smelling fresh between grooming sessions, particularly useful for dogs with naturally strong scents.
  • Allergies and flea products: If your dog uses topical flea controls, verify compatibility. Some shampoos are designed to be safe with these treatments.
  • Ingredients and scent: Many owners prefer natural, plant-based ingredients and light, non-overpowering scents for a pleasant, non-irritating wash experience.
  • Frequency of use: Some formulas are gentle enough for daily or frequent use, while others are better suited for every 2–4 weeks. Consider your grooming schedule and coat maintenance needs.
  • Size and value: Choose a size appropriate for your dog’s coat length and your washing frequency. Larger breeds or frequent bathed dogs benefit from bigger bottles with cost efficiency.
  • Safety and approvals: Look for veterinary-endorsed or well-reviewed products. Check for any warnings about contact with eyes or mucous membranes and rinse thoroughly.
